Biography

Diego Biello

Mini bio

  • Diego Biello is an Italian producer graduated from the Catholic University of the Sacred Heart of Milan with Francesco Casetti today a professor at the University of Yale and Nevina Satta president of the Sardinia Film Commission, specialized in film production and in the management of international companies for culture and for the show. His career on the Italian sets began in 2005 covering organizational and production figures, in 2008 he supported the Milanese scenes of the film "Somewhere" by Sofia Coppola as a reference in Italy of the producer Fred Roos and in 2009 he worked for Summit Entertainment on the American set of " Letters to Juliet "and meets Mark Canton of which he becomes assistant producer for 5 years alongside him in sets between Europe, Africa and the United States for films such as" 300 Ryse of an Empire "with Warner Bros," The cold light of the day "with Bruce Willis distributed by Movie Max and" The Pyramid "for 20th Century Fox. In 2015, after other management experiences as a minority shareholder in various production companies in Italy and abroad, Filmedea s.r.l. was born. which produces web content for 20th Century Fox for the launch of international films including "The Revenant" and experiments with new production languages for web cinema and TV. Over the years he has co-produced various Italian films for the cinema of moderate success and one film in particular "Diminuta" which has had great success with the public in the South American market. In 2018 he won a European tender with which he opened a production and post-production studio and purchased proprietary equipment and means to increase the services to be offered to international productions with which Filmedea co-produces and welcomes productions in Europe from all over the world. He is developing various international films of which he holds option rights on behalf of various American producers with whom he has worked during his career and develops various stories based on successful novels and ready to be shot using connections with first level professionals.
